You will find that the last day of any month restaraunts will have a limited stock. Especially end of the year. This is primarily because after the store closes at night they have to do "end of the month" inventory. Well, since everything has to be weighed, measured, and counted, a smart manager will allow the amount they have to count dwindle the last few days of the month. Am guilty of that practice myself. Makes for a faster count since there is less to count. Now that is no excuse in failing to let customers know what is not available. And you should never run out of any signature items. Especially if the product is part of your company name. I went to Ryans Steakhouse a few years back and believe it or not, they were out of ribeyes, t-bones, filets, and Strips. All they had was sirloins available and I wont eat sirloin. I consider it a cheap peice of meat. Needless to say I had the grilled chicken.

You talking about Pier 76 hotel? Near the downtown bridge? Thats been gone for quite a few years now. If you fish that area alot try trolling some 2 inch rapalas. If you get below roark creek(below BassPro), troll deeper with some medium diving cranks. Might not catch as many fish but your catch size will get alot better. Also, If you get down towards Rockaway and find some 20 to 30 foot areas, look for cover in your graph and vertical jig above it with jigging spoons. Thats where your big brownies like to nest. Have to be patient with the spoons. I can jig for 2 or 3 hours and only catch one fish. But it is almost always over 3 pounds. I can average 5 to 7 pounds per fish on most days but I know where all the cover is already. Less time hunting. Fish the cover fast, if you dont get a hit in 20 to 30 minutes find more. Just like if your Bass fishing.
